Nawanshahr , April 23, 2020 : Member of Parliament from Sri Anandpur Sahib Manish Tewari has been taking up the issue of people stuck in other states of the country due to the lock down in the wake of Corona epidemic with the concerned state governments including Punjab Chief Minister Capt Amarinder Singh. Tewari is confident that they will be repatriated as soon as possible.
MP Tewari said that he had received information from MLA Darshan Lal Mangupur from Balachaur that many people from his constituency were stranded in Maharashtra, Madhya Pradesh, Odisha and Gujarat. Similarly, Love Kumar Goldy, a former MLA from Garhshankar, said that people from other areas, including Saila Khurd village in his constituency, were stranded in different parts of the country due to the lock down . However, many other people's representatives and party workers are giving the same information from the people of the area.
He said that this matter was very serious and he was taking it up with the Chief Minister of Punjab and the Chief Ministers of the concerned states and the Union Government to ensure that the people who were stranded in different parts of the country could be brought back to their homes as soon as possible.
